GENERAL DESCRIPTION

Horizon Europe is the EU’s key funding programme for research and innovation, with a budget of €95.5 billion. It addresses climate change, supports the achievement of the UN’s Sustainable Development Goals, and enhances the EU’s competitiveness and growth. The programme facilitates collaboration and strengthens the impact of research and innovation in developing, supporting, and implementing EU policies while addressing global challenges. It promotes the creation and dissemination of excellent knowledge and technologies. Additionally, it creates jobs, fully engages the EU’s talent pool, boosts economic growth, promotes industrial competitiveness, and optimises investment impact within a strengthened European Research Area. Legal entities from the EU and associated countries can participate.

Systemic circular solutions for sustainable tourism

(HORIZON Innovation Actions, planned opening 17/10/23, HORIZON-CL6-2024-CircBio-01-4)

Deadline: 22 February 2024

DESCRIPTION

The project aims to foster sustainability within the tourism sector by promoting circular tourism services, minimising harmful substances and waste, and optimising resource utilisation. It seeks to implement systemic solutions tailored to various regions and promote circular, zero-pollution, and climate-neutral practices among service providers and users. The initiative also aims to introduce innovative solutions and affordable technologies to facilitate the transition towards circularity in tourism.

SPECIFIC OBJECTIVES

(1) Propagate circular tourism services.

(2) Minimise harmful substances and waste.

(3) Optimise energy, land, and water utilisation.

(4) Implement replicable systemic solutions for diverse territorial needs.

(5)Promote circular, zero-pollution, and climate-neutral practices.

(6) Introduce innovative solutions and affordable technologies, including AI, robotics, IoT, and blockchain.
